Announced Wednesday, Deutsche Tekelom’s T-Systems MMS joins Chainlink as its node operator, according to the official website of T-Systems.

As a node operator, T-Systems MMS earns digital assets for ensuring the reliable connection of external data to the network’s smart contracts. Titled “generalized mining”, this innovative form of collaboration is very important for the crypto world. Gleb Dudka, an analyst at T-Systems MMS, also noted that further integration than node operating is possible. 

According to Bitpush data, Chainlink is now the 10th largest cryptocurrency trading at $7.46 at the time of writing.
